Girard-Perregaux.
Its origins go back to the moment when the young Jean-François Bautte set out on the path of the watchmaker at the age of twelve.
In 1791, at twenty-one, he produced his first original model, and watchmaking began under the name of the Bautte company.
It was that company which later took the Girard-Perregaux name and wrote itself into history as the fourth-oldest watch brand in the world.
